What is an SEO consultant?



An SEO consultant is an expert in web optimization, both in the recommendations and in the implementation of tools and strategies aimed at positioning your website high in SERPs.
The functions of the consultant that you hire must be totally focused on achieving a single objective: That your page appears in the first results to drive more traffic and, in turn, more sales.

In other words, SEO is key in your digital marketing strategies. It is as important as your social media strategy and you have to pay attention to it.

What are the functions of an SEO consultant?



Statistical analysis of your website:

This is achieved thanks to the use of tools such as Google Analytics or other programs that allow you to see the current traffic on your website. Visitors can be reviewed by country, region, gender, age range, interests, etc. All this, visible through lines or time ranges. This allows you to make tactical and strategic decisions.

  • Advice for optimizing your website


This refers to the changes necessary to make your website load quickly, be seen on any device and be easy to navigate, as well as pleasing to the eye.

The quality of the images used and the readability of the site play an important role here.
In other words, the images must be of good quality, but not too big. They should still be able to look good from a mobile phone or from a PC or desktop computer.



Also, the paragraphs and sentences in your content should be short and easy to read. Here, the SEO consultant might even recommend outsourcing a content writer for your blog. So that a writing expert is in charge of the form, as well as the inclusion of keywords that the consultant recommends after their analysis.

  • Keyword research

As already mentioned, the SEO consultant is in charge of auditing the data of your site to find which keywords you are missing from your site. The aim of this is to allow your website to rank for more keywords.

  • On-page SEO

This refers to organizing the content of your website or blog to allow it to be indexed as well as optimizing the URLs, titles and content to include the targeted keywords. Internal linking might also be an important feature that you are missing from your website. Another important point is that you must know how to analyze the content of your competitors and be able to offer superior content.


  • Link building (or Off-page SEO)

An SEO consultant will also have knowledge of techniques for obtaining and conducting an analysis of sites that have content linked to your website.

This helps your site have a better search engine ranking by serving as a reference on other sites, giving your website or blog more authority in Google’s eyes.
  • Local SEO
Local SEO is becoming increasingly important in recent times. An SEO consultant will help your company rank for local keywords and in local maps and services such as Google Maps.

Key questions to ask consultants before hiring


How and how often will the communication take place: Remember that they must be in constant communication. Any major changes to the site should be discussed with you first before approval.

How often will a comparative statistics report be delivered to you: They should periodically report the changes and statistics shown by the tools implemented. It can be weekly, monthly, even quarterly. Agree on the frequency of this.

What are the goals of the website: The consultant must offer you a concrete plan for SEO audits and the future position of your sites, how long of a time frame they need to complete this work. SEO is progressive and so all goals should follow with this line of thinking. Every month goals should be analyzed and realized.
